Communications Manager

When registering to this job board you will be redirected to the online application form. Please ensure that this is completed in full in order that your application can be reviewed.

Nescot is recognised as the Employer of the year at the Surrey Business Awards 2024 and offers a wide range of benefits and wellbeing activities to staff.

What we are looking for:

Confident communicator with exceptional written and verbal skills, capable of translating complex information into clear, compelling messages that resonate across diverse stakeholder groups and aligns with Nescot s culture and values. A strong grasp of digital communications, analytics, and media trends, along with sound strategic judgment to advise senior leaders and managers on communications and sensitive or high–profile issues. Experience leading or developing small teams and a collaborative mindset that enables you to build strong relationships across departments and levels. Experience of working within the Further Education sector is desirable, but not essential.

Duties/responsibilities:

Lead Nescot s communications function, ensuring clear, engaging, and consistent messaging across all internal and external channels Work closely with the marketing team, curriculum departments, and the College Leadership Team (CLT) Establish and lead a professional communications function that supports collaboration, enhances visibility, and strengthens stakeholder engagement.
